ICC Cricket World Cup - practice and media conference arrangements for Monday 9 April

The following are the arrangements for the remaining eight teams on 9 April:
  • In Guyana, Ireland takes on New Zealand at the Guyana National Stadium, Providence in what will be the final game of the ICC Cricket World Cup at that venue. Play starts at 0930 and afterwards, there will be media conferences involving both captains and the man of the match.
  • In Grenada, South Africa will hold a training session at Grenada National Stadium, Queen's Park, from 0900 until around 1130. At about 1100, coach Mickey Arthur will hold a media conference. The West Indies will hold a training session at the same venue from 1200 until around 1430. Beforehand, captain Brian Lara will hold a media conference.
  • Also in Grenada, Sri Lanka has opted not to hold a training session and has no plans for a media conference.
  • In Antigua, England has opted not to hold a training session. The ECB has indicated that coach Duncan Fletcher will hold a media conference for print media only at the team hotel at 0845.   • In Barbados, Bangladesh is scheduled to train at Windward Cricket Club, St Philip from 0900 until 1200. Afterwards a player is expected to hold a media conference.
